Rep. Moore Participates in Markup of Build Back Better Act to Tackle Climate Change, Fight Poverty, Expand and Lower the Cost of Health Care, and Increase Access to Affordable Housing

WASHINGTON, Sept. 17 -- Rep. Gwen Moore, D-Wisconsin, issued the following statement on Sept. 15, 2021:

The Ways and Means Committee approved its portion of the Build Back Better Act, which included provisions to address climate change, extend the Child Tax Credit (CTC) and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C) expansions, improve the Low-Income Housing Tax Credit, lower the cost of prescription drugs, and close the Medicaid coverage gap in states who refused to expand . . .
